About Swaminath Srinivas
Swaminath Srinivas is a scholar working on Molecular Medicine, Endocrinology and Genetics, having authored 38 papers that have together received 1.2k indexed citations. Recurring topics across this work include Bacterial Genetics and Biotechnology (11 papers), Antibiotic Resistance in Bacteria (10 papers) and Vibrio bacteria research studies (4 papers). The work is most often cited by research in Molecular Medicine (639 citations), Endocrinology (209 citations) and Pollution (232 citations). Swaminath Srinivas has collaborated with scholars based in United States, China and India. Frequent co-authors include Youjun Feng, Jingxia Lin, Yongchang Xu, Wenhui Wei, Huimin Zhang, K. Govindaraju, Jian Sun, Shihua Wang, Rongsui Gao and Guo‐Bao Tian. Their work appears in journals such as Journal of Biological Chemistry, PLoS ONE and Journal of Agricultural and Food Chemistry.
